Well, USCC is a much smaller carrier than what Nextel was when they were acquired by Sprint. Plus, as I stated, USCC has announced plans to move to LTE, which will be the same 4G standard that AT&T will use.

In Puerto Rico, Verizon sold their network to America Movil and was rebranded as Claro. Claro in Puerto Rico is gradually converting the Verizon CDMA network to GSM/UMTS.
